			Merge pull request #60 from matrix-org/rav/vector_search
Refactor the search stuff in RoomView * factor out the call to MatrixClient.search to a separate _getSearchBatch (so that we can reuse it for paginated results in a bit) * Don't group cross-room searches by room - just display them in timeline order.pull/21833/head
